docker es8集群搭建
时间: 2023-08-25 08:14:01 浏览: 212
要搭建Docker ES8集群,可以按照以下步骤进行操作:
1. 首先,确保你已经安装了Docker和Docker Compose。
2. 创建一个Docker Compose文件,例如docker-compose.yml,在该文件中定义你的ES集群配置。可以使用以下示例配置:
```yaml
version: '3'
services:
elasticsearch:
image: docker.elastic.co/elasticsearch/elasticsearch:8.0.1
environment:
- discovery.type=single-node
ports:
- 9200:9200
volumes:
- esdata:/usr/share/elasticsearch/data
volumes:
esdata:
```
3. 在终端中,导航到包含docker-compose.yml文件的目录。
4. 运行以下命令以启动集群:
```
docker-compose up -d
```
这将启动一个单节点的Elasticsearch集群,并将其绑定到本地的9200端口。
5. 要停止集群,可以运行以下命令:
```
docker-compose down
```
这将停止容器,但保留Docker卷中的数据。
希望以上步骤可以帮助你成功搭建Docker ES8集群。如果有任何问题,请随时提问。<em>1</em><em>2</em><em>3</em>
#### 引用[.reference_title]
- *1* *3* [Elasticsearch(4) 利用docker-compose搭建es8集群环境](https://blog.csdn.net/m0_66557301/article/details/123892665)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}} ] [.reference_item]
- *2* [搭建Elasticsearch8.0集群](https://blog.csdn.net/qq_39677803/article/details/123279194)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}} ] [.reference_item]
[ .reference_list ]
阅读全文